If you've been holding off finishing Mass Effect 3 due to the crappy ending, you can start playing it again as BioWare has given into the complaints and will be releasing a new ending via free DLC. Not long after EA announced that The Old Republic's subscription numbers didn't increase after most player's free month ended; they launched a buddy program where existing players could invite up to three friends to try out the game. Back when Disney released Tron Legacy in theaters, they disguised a monorail at Walt Disney World as a light cycle. This year's World of Warcraft expansion, Mists of Pandaria, will include a character from the funniest movie ever made: The The Killer Rabbit of Caerbannog from Monty Python and the Holy Grail.
